Cookies
The website www.ott.at uses cookies. These are text files that are stored on a computer system via an Internet browser. Most websites and servers use cookies. Many cookies contain a so-called cookie ID. This is a unique identifier for the cookie. It consists of a string of characters that allows websites and servers to be assigned to the specific Internet browser in which the cookie was stored. This enables the websites and servers visited to distinguish the individual browser of the person concerned from other Internet browsers that contain other cookies. A specific Internet browser can be recognized and identified via the unique cookie ID. By using cookies, Weingut Ott can provide visitors to the website www.ott.at with more user-friendly services that would not be possible without the use of cookies. Cookies enable the website www.ott.at to recognize users in order to make it easier for them to use. Every visitor to the website www.ott.at can prevent the setting of cookies at any time by adjusting the settings of their Internet browser. Cookies that have already been set can be deleted at any time via the Internet browser or other software programs. This is possible in all common Internet browsers. However, deactivation may mean that not all functions of the website www.ott.at are available.
